(1) In case the Centralized Call Center is aware about the reason of power failure of the complainant, the complainant shall be informed about the reason and the approximate time required for restoration of power supply.
(2) However, such complaint shall be registered and a unique complaint number shall be issued.
(3) The Centralized Call Center shall forward the complaint to the concerned Complaint Center.
(4) The complaint shall be resolved within the timelines as specified under these Regulations.
(5) The details of scheduled Power Outages shall be informed to the consumers in the manner notified in the Commission’s Orders.
(6) The Licensee shall keep a record of all scheduled power outages and unscheduled power outages separately and the extent of consumers affected by each power outage.
(7) If the Licensee fails to restore the supply within the specified timelines, compensation shall be paid to the affected consumers as specified in Schedule-I of the Regulations.
